Analysis

Peru recorded 0.02 for raw milk of cattle — revealed comparative advantage index in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 15 years on record.

The figure is down 33.3% on the previous year and down 90.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, raw milk of cattle — revealed comparative advantage index in Peru peaked at 0.31 in 2012 and was at its lowest, 0.02, in 2017.

That places Peru 86th out of 128 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The food and agricultural trade indicators dataset is based on trade, production and gross domestic product (GDP) data. Agri-food trade data are collected, processed and disseminated by FAO according to the standard International Merchandise Trade Statistics (IMTS) Methodology. The data is mainly provided by UNSD, Eurostat, and other national authorities as needed. The source data is checked for outliers, trade partner data is used for non-reporting countries or missing cells, and data on food aid is added to take total cross-border trade flows into account. The trade database includes the following variables: export quantity, export value, import quantity, and import value. It includes all food and agricultural products imported/exported annually by all countries in the world.
